What is UPVC?
UPVC is a kind of plastic that is widely used in the building and construction market, particularly for window and door frames. Unlike routine PVC, UPVC does not consist of plasticizers, which makes it rigid and appropriate for structural applications. The product is resistant to moisture and environmental deterioration, giving it a longer life expectancy compared to conventional materials like wood and metal.

Types of UPVC Windows and Doors
UPVC items been available in numerous designs to suit different architectural styles and personal choices. Some typical types include:
Windows:
- Casement Windows: Hinged at the side, these windows open external, supplying exceptional ventilation.
- Sliding Windows: These windows operate on a track, permitting for easy opening and closing.
- Sash Windows: Featuring sliding panes, sash windows supply a conventional look and performance.
- Tilt and Turn Windows: Versatile in style, these windows can tilt for ventilation or turn completely for easy cleaning.
Doors:
- UPVC Front Doors: Designed to supply security and insulation, these doors are available in numerous designs.
- French Doors: These double doors open outward and develop a seamless link to outside areas.
- Sliding Patio Doors: Ideal for maximizing views and natural light, these doors run efficiently along a track.
- Bi-fold Doors: These doors can fold back to develop an open area, perfect for amusing or connecting indoor and outside areas.

Installation Process
The installation of UPVC windows and doors is crucial for ensuring their functionality and durability. Here are the crucial steps associated with the setup procedure:
Measurement: Accurate measurements of the existing openings are taken.
Preparation: The old frames are removed, and the area is cleaned and prepped for the new installation.
Positioning: The new UPVC frames are placed, guaranteeing they fit snugly within the openings.
Sealing: The frames are sealed using appropriate sealing products to avoid drafts and water ingress.
Ending up: Final modifications are made to ensure the windows and doors operate smoothly, and any complements are added.
Upkeep Tips for UPVC Windows and Doors
To keep UPVC windows and doors in great condition, the following upkeep ideas are recommended:
Regular Cleaning: Use a wet cloth or sponge with moderate soap to wipe down the frames and glass surfaces. Prevent extreme chemicals that can harm the material.
Check Seals and Locks: Regularly inspect the sealing and locking systems to guarantee they are operating properly.
Lube Moving Parts: Use a silicone-based lube on hinges and locks to keep them operating smoothly.
Look for Damage: Periodically examine for any visible damage or use to attend to problems before they escalate.
